HomeSort by relevance Sort by last modified time
    Searched full:cmpxchgl (Results 1 - 25 of 34) sorted by null

1 2

  /external/llvm/test/CodeGen/X86/
atomic32.ll 76 ; X64: cmpxchgl
79 ; X32: cmpxchgl
101 ; X64: cmpxchgl
104 ; X32: cmpxchgl
126 ; X64: cmpxchgl
129 ; X32: cmpxchgl
147 ; X64: cmpxchgl
151 ; X32: cmpxchgl
165 ; X64: cmpxchgl
170 ; X32: cmpxchgl
    [all...]
atomic_op.ll 44 ; CHECK: cmpxchgl
49 ; CHECK: cmpxchgl
54 ; CHECK: cmpxchgl
59 ; CHECK: cmpxchgl
65 ; CHECK: cmpxchgl
70 ; CHECK: cmpxchgl
75 ; CHECK: cmpxchgl
80 ; CHECK: cmpxchgl
85 ; CHECK: cmpxchgl
90 ; CHECK: cmpxchgl
    [all...]
cmpxchg-i1.ll 5 ; CHECK: cmpxchgl
35 ; CHECK-DAG: cmpxchgl
47 ; CHECK: cmpxchgl
64 ; CHECK: cmpxchgl [[NEW]], (%rdi)
2008-09-17-inline-asm-1.ll 23 %asmtmp = tail call { i32, i32 } asm "movl $0, %eax\0A\090:\0A\09test %eax, %eax\0A\09je 1f\0A\09movl %eax, $2\0A\09incl $2\0A\09lock\0A\09cmpxchgl $2, $0\0A\09jne 0b\0A\091:", "=*m,=&{ax},=&r,*m,~{dirflag},~{fpsr},~{flags},~{memory},~{cc}"(i32* %pw, i32* %pw) nounwind
24 %asmtmp2 = tail call { i32, i32 } asm "movl $0, %edx\0A\090:\0A\09test %edx, %edx\0A\09je 1f\0A\09movl %edx, $2\0A\09incl $2\0A\09lock\0A\09cmpxchgl $2, $0\0A\09jne 0b\0A\091:", "=*m,=&{dx},=&r,*m,~{dirflag},~{fpsr},~{flags},~{memory},~{cc}"(i32* %pw, i32* %pw) nounwind
2010-09-16-asmcrash.ll 43 %0 = call i8 asm sideeffect "\09lock ; \09\09\09cmpxchgl $2,$1 ;\09 sete\09$0 ;\09\091:\09\09\09\09# atomic_cmpset_int", "={ax},=*m,r,{ax},*m,~{memory},~{dirflag},~{fpsr},~{flags}"(i32* %tmp4, i32 undef, i32 undef, i32* %tmp4) nounwind, !srcloc !0
atomic-dagsched.ll 102 ; CHECK-NOT: cmpxchgl